PATHWAY TO ENGLISH

Lesson Plan: Novel


This lesson plan accompanies Pathway to English: Chapter 9 Overall, It’s an Excellent Movie.

This lesson is suitable for students at the senior high school grade 3.

Lesson Goals
1. To understand the novel
2. To practice using planning strategies
3. To increase students understanding about novel

Activity (see brackets for resources required) Time Interaction


needed
Warmer (Copy part of the story or novel 1 paragraph of the novel for 20 mins
each group and include resources)

 Ask students to read or listen about the life/background of the 5 mins T-S
novel.
 Ask students to discuss in groups regarding the title suggested 10 mins T-S
by the teacher.
 Ask students to make general predictions about the story on a
novel given by the teacher. 2 mins T-S
 Ask students to predict the genre of the novel. 2 mins T-S
 Students are asked to find an important lexical in the story and
then match the word with their own definition. 6 mins S-S

Main activities (copies of Resource 2, 3 and 4 for individuals) 45 mins

 Ask students to find difficult vocabulary (unfamiliar


vocabulary) in the novel. 15min T-S

 Determine the list of adjectives that match the


characters based on the novel, then sort the characters 15 mins S-S
in the novel story and students are asked to write
different characters for each character.

 Students are asked to fill in the correct tenses in the part


of the verb that has been left blank by the teacher and 15 mins T-S then S
then students compare it with the original text in the
novel.

Extension activity (copies of marks and results pages 107/108 and 25 mins
Resource 5 for individuals)
 Students debate about the results of discussions that focus on
controversial points on questions that have been raised by the 10 mins S-S
teacher.

 Students are asked to write several paragraphs using a certain T-S then S
story style and then students write story reviews. 10 mins

 Students discuss about the novel then do a role-play or act out a


scene in the novel then summarize the value of the story. 5 mins S-S

Task 2
Group A
Look for some words that are difficult to understand in chapter 1-13. Discuss what the words
on your list mean in the context of the story. You can use your dictionaries to help you. When you
have finished, explain the meaning of the words to the students in the other group.
